Standard Animal Intruders and Their Behavioral Patterns

Different animals often invade homes, each displaying unique actions that can cause major problems for property owners. Mice and rats like mice and rats are famous for their nesting patterns, often seeking shelter in basements or attics. They can gnaw through wires, insulation, and even food packaging, posing health risks and property damage. Raccoons, attracted to garbage and pet food, are adept climbers and can readily access roofs and attics, making messes and potential entry points for further infestations.

Squirrels, while seemingly harmless, can result in significant property destruction by gnawing on wood and wiring. Opossums, frequently misjudged, may enter areas looking for sustenance but can also attract predators. Finally, skunks present a distinctive problem, as their strong odor can saturate buildings when they sense danger. Understanding these intruders' behaviors is essential for preventing potential property damage and safety risks.

Identify Animal Invasion Indicators

In what ways can property owners quickly recognize signs of wildlife intrusion? Recognizing early indicators is important to preserving the safety of your property. Regular signs include unusual noises, such as scraping or scurrying sounds, commonly heard at night. Homeowners should also look for droppings, which differ depending on the species but indicate recent activity. Damaged wires, insulation, or food packaging can indicate rodent or raccoon activity. Tracks or paw prints near openings can indicate the species of animal that is entering. Uncommon holes or burrows in the yard or near the foundation are warning signals. Finally, damaged plants or disturbed nesting materials may signify wildlife is making itself at home. Quick identification facilitates swift intervention and prevention.

Advice for Deterring Wildlife Intrusions

Homeowners should take early steps to stop wildlife encroachments by discouraging animals from entering their estates. The first action involves sealing any openings in foundations, walls, and roofs, because even the smallest gaps can serve as entry points for various creatures. Next, keeping a well-maintained yard free from food sources like pet food or fallen fruit can minimize attractants. Moreover, garbage should be stored in animal-proof containers to minimize odors that might draw wildlife. Installing motion-activated lights and fencing can further enhance security by creating a less welcoming environment. Lastly, keeping trees and shrubs properly trimmed deters animals from making homes nearby. By applying these tactics, homeowners can effectively cut the risk of wildlife intrusions, ensuring a comfortable and more reliable living environment.
